QIX Launches in Cologix’s Data Center

Cologix, a network neutral interconnection and colocation company, announced that the Quebec Internet Exchange (QIX) has deployed its core node in Cologix’s facility at 1250 Rene Levesque in support of its recently launched peering exchange. The peering point will enable a new era in interconnection in Quebec by enabling streamlined, settlement-free peering relationships, says the company.

In connection with this launch, Cologix recently introduced the Standard Connections product in Montreal, which is a tailor-made product that provides a low cost point of presence in 1250 Rene Levesque to access the QIX as well as the Cologix Meet-Me-Room. The QIX is a non-profit association, led by some of the largest names in the Quebec Internet community with broad support from public and private sector stakeholders.

“With access to eight million Quebec residents, and with 2-plus million households with fixed line broadband subscriptions, Montreal is the natural home for the new Quebec Internet Exchange,” said Sylvie LaPerriere, Chairperson of the QIX and Program Manager for Peering and Content Distribution at Google. “QIX represents a critical step towards creating a more robust domestic Internet, not just in Quebec, but across Canada.”

For QIX members, the new exchange point will:

  • Reduce IP transit costs, thanks to settlement-free or cost-free peering arrangements between the members of QIX, which includes Internet service providers and other corporate and public sector partners throughout Quebec;
  • Improve performance and reduce costs for consumers by keeping traffic local without round tripping to exchanges in Toronto or New York;
  • Provide close proximity to the European cable landing stations in Halifax; and
  • Allow service providers and other private and public sector partners to establish new peering relationships with low administrative burdens.

Cologix partnered with QIX throughout the organization process and is providing space and power on a long term basis.

“Cologix is thrilled to support the QIX launch. Based on our experience with exchanges in Toronto (TORIX) and Minneapolis (MICE), we are strong believers that the independent, association model leads to strong credibility within the peering community,” said Roger Brulotte, Cologix Montreal General Manager. “We have high expectations that QIX will get off to a fast start and look forward to providing easy access for prospective members through our Standard Connections product.”
